Purpose:

To serve a Hygiene Emergency Prohibition Notice (HEPN)

Decision:

An Hygiene Emergency Prohibition Notice was served on the FBO of a business on Front Street Arnold. This was to prohibit the use of 3 pieces of equipment at the premises. The FBO was also given a Food Hygiene Rating scheme score of '0' at the time of the visit.

Reasons for the decision:

The premises open and serving high risk ready to eat products. There was no running hot and cold water to the premises. No ready to use antibacterial cleaning spray or soap detergent for cleaning. No antibacterial soap or hand drying materials for staff to wash their hands, creating a risk of cross contamination of the high risk ready to eat foods with food poisoning bacteria. Therefore presenting an imminent risk to public health. Plus there was no documented food safety management system on site and no paperwork had been received Gedling Borough Council to register the food business

Alternative options considered:

Informal - general letter
Hygiene Improvement Notices
Voluntary Closure
